Turmeric Poached Fish with Rice and Chilli Floss

Ready in 25 minutes Serves 1
This dish most recently appeared in My Classic (5 Meals For 1) on Sunday, February 18, 2018.

Just use a small spinkle of chilli floss, a little goes a long way.


Ingredients

Rice

  • ½ cup basmati rice
  • ¾ cup water

Turmeric Poached Fish

  • 150g fish fillet
  • 30g turmeric paste
  • 1 can coconut milk
  • ¼ cup chicken stock
  • ½ tablespoon fish sauce
  • ½ teaspo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on soy sauce
  • Juice of ¼ lemon

Salad

  • ½ Lebanese cucumber
  • 2 radishes
  • ½ carrot
  • 1-2 tablespoons roughly chopped coriander
  • 1 teaspo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on rice wine vinegar

To Serve

  • Pinch of chilli floss

Steps

  1. Set aside all ingredients. Combine rice, water and a pinch of salt in a small pot and bring to the boil. As soon as it boils, cover with a tight-fitting lid and reduce to lowest heat to cook for 12 minutes. Turn off heat and leave to steam, still covered, for a further 8 minutes. Do not lift lid during cooking.
  2. Heat a drizzle of oil in a pot (with a lid) on medium heat. Cook turmeric paste with 1 tablespoon of coconut milk for about 30 seconds, stirring, until fragrant. Add all coconut milk, stock, fish sauce, sugar and soy sauce and simmer for about 3 minutes.
  3. Pat fish dry, remove any remaining scales or bones, and cut into 3cm pieces. Add lemon juice and fish to pot, stir to cover fish in sauce, cover with a lid and turn off heat. Leave fish to steam for about 5 minutes, until just cooked through. Season to taste with extra fish sauce and soy sauce if needed.
  4. Thinly slice cucumber on an angle; cut radishes into matchsticks or thinly slice; peel carrot into ribbons; roughly chop coriander. Place all in a bowl, along with olive oil and vinegar, toss to combine and season.
  5. To serve, spoon ¾ cup cooked rice onto a plate and top with turmeric poached fish and sauce. Sprinkle over chilli floss and serve salad on the side.
